Hill's Half Marathon!!!


I got to run my first half marathon in Marrakesh a few weeks ago. It was definitely a surreal experience, as we were running through trash, by old, walled cities and by local markets, with some random people taking pictures of us four white girls. We were famous:) The water stations along the way were far and few between and very basic, but we were also lucky to experience the "eponge," (where they gave us sponges with water on them to cool down). I really enjoyed that experience until I found out that they were reusing the sponges that people had already used and thrown on the ground. Needless to say, we finished in 2 hours and 10 minutes!
